#268FDF Hex color

#268FDF

The hexadecimal color code #268FDF corresponds to the code RGB( 38, 143, 223 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,15 level), green (at 0,56 level) and blue (at 0,87 level). Its brightness is 51% and its saturation is 74%. It is composed of red at 9%, green at 35% and blue at 55%.
